How long do you smoke for?

Assume the waiting let's the flavour mellow?

i go 4 hours, but that is up to you. scroll up on previous page to see that i cut standard kraft/cabot/tillamook or whatever brand you choose into smaller blocks for smaller servings.

here are the cliff notes:

4 hours in smoke (rotate every hour)
bring indoors and wrap individually in parchment paper and put in fridge for 24 hours
after 24 hours vacuum seal individually and put back in the fridge
rest time is basically 1 week per hour of smoke time (so if i go 4 hours i wait a month before opening)

enjoy for months and months and months
